Some Hairstyles For Thin Hair
Layered with side swept bangs
Layered hair looks very classy and is actually a really nice hairstyle to cover thin hair. Layered with side swept bangs doesn’t emphasize your thin hair, because instead of emphasizing the thinness, it actually thickens the hair appearance. A huge majority of celebrities with thin hair had this hairstyle, as it does thicken the hair. Reese Witherspoon, Cameron Diaz, and Keira Knightly, tried this hairstyle out and their slightly thin hair instantly looked thick.
Short Layered Bob Cut
A short layered bob cut is one of the most sophisticated hairstyles for thin hair out there. This very stylish hair cut is also very dynamic, as it is a perfect hair cut for simply any event.
This hairstyle is so dynamic that even celebrities go to red carpet events with the haircut.
A layered Bob cut makes a very cool illusion that your hair is thicker, which is why celebrities love the style. Katie Holmes, Rihanna, and Posh, all know that this hairstyle flatters the face and also elongates the body. If you have thin hair, this hairstyle is perfect for you.
Pixie Cut
If you no longer have that much hair, that doesn’t necessarily mean that you can’t have stylish hair. The pixie haircut is a very edgy short hairstyle that a huge amount of celebrities pull off.
Pixie hairstyles for thin hair will not only thicken the hair, but also flatter your face. It is a very bold and liberating hairstyle that flatters almost every face shape, including people with round face shape.
Short Shaggy Hair
Short shaggy hair is a very stunning hairstyle that women with thin hair will look great in.
When your hair is shaggy, you will give the illusion of thick and full hair. This hairstyle is still very much in style, as a lot of celebrities still have this hairstyle. Celebrities like Taylor Momsen, Jessica Alba, and Jennifer Aniston, had this hairstyle, as it is very stylish.
Every girl with thin hair will really look great in this, as it isn’t obvious that you are trying to hide your thin hair.
Hairstyles To Avoid
A couple of hairstyles that women with thin hair should avoid is super straight hair, as it can make your hair look even thinner. One more hairstyle that you should avoid is pinning your hair up like what Snooki Pollizzi does. When you stick your hair up, people could possibly see that your hair is becoming thin.
